Output 7a14510762a58d2d463529e4e6d74292426065043d4b4863ed99d82f1a2fa386:0

value
786300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8c6696e00b1534bbeebf658c94455a4ce5463a OP_EQUAL
address
3EWAicbBRax5CJJLgrVCcf9D1A5ERCoSzU
transaction
7a14510762a58d2d463529e4e6d74292426065043d4b4863ed99d82f1a2fa386
confirmations
388752
spent
true